华为电脑管家录屏文件损坏修复一例
老婆matebook自带的华为电脑管家挺方便的,内置录屏功能。前两天由于电脑原因(蓝屏)导致录屏文件损坏,录制的课程很重要,于是就动手修复,记一下修复过程。
如上图,录屏文件只有非常简单的媒体信息
找到一个能用的软件 Video Repair Tool,选择之前正常录制的视频作为参考源,然后就能修复损坏的视频
确实是修复了,播放器能正常打开视频。但是……音频流是对了,但是视频流却异常(表现为超速播放,帧率不对?)
一开始想的是直接拖到Premiere里拉长视频解决,但是拖到PR里时又提示:文件的压缩类型不受支持
突然就想到可能是视频流的编码不对(咱也不懂,咱也不问),还是查看媒体信息
发现这个 isom 不是我常见的东西啊…… 那就尝试转换一下,几番寻找,又找到 GPAC(实际只用到其中包含的MP4Box组件)
mp4box.exe -brand mp42 "D:\repaired\20211024_083015.mp4"
转换完成,再次尝试拖到PR里。卧槽,可以了
但是……特喵的,问题又来了,音频流的时长怎么短了?也就是视频因为帧率不对导致只有27秒(如上图),可是我原本的音频流有16分钟多啊
好吧,那就分开执行,先查看音频流媒体信息,然后用FFMPEG提取音频流
得到其音频为AAC编码,那就直接提取为m4a格式
ffmpeg -i 20211024_084808.mp4 -vn -codec copy 20211024_084808.m4a
继续拖到PR里,终于OK了
最后一步,修改视频流的时长,和音频流保持一致,就可以导出了
一条评论
这都能折腾好,技术宅改变世界!